A narrative of a new and unusual American imprisonment, of two Presbyterian ministers, and prosecution of Mr. Francis Makemie one of them, for preaching one sermon in the city of New-York.
1755, Re-printed and sold by H. Gaine, at the printing-office, between the Fly and Meal-Markets
Microform
in English

Book Details
Edition Notes
Attributed to Francis Makemie in: Sprague, William. Annals of the American pulpit.
Dedication signed: The author of The watch-tower [i.e., William Livingston].
Signatures: A⁴ B² C-H⁴ I² (gatherings E, F missigned D, E).
Evans 7455.
Microfiche. [New York : Readex Microprint, 1985] 11 x 15 cm. (Early American imprints. First series ; no. 7455).
